NCIP Funding - 03 February 2012

Six million euro of capital funding for the National Childcare Investment Programme (NCIP) was announced by the Government in 2012 and this opened for applications on Thursday 2nd February 2012. If you are interested in this funding you should contact you local Childcare Committee for details and assistance on how to apply.

FETAC Awards - 04 January 2012

FETAC are currently revising all their awards. The College supports this change as it will lead to clarity in the awards for both learners and employers. From December 2012 FETAC will only accept the new awards for accreditation. Beyond December 2012 Learners will be able to use a limited number of their old component certificates to go towards the new award. One significant change is that the Childcare Level 6 Award will now require 8 component certificates where currently it only requires 5. The College would advise learners who wish to obtain the Childcare Level 6 award to commence their award in April/May 2012 so they can be finished by December 2012. Otherwise learners will have to complete 8 component certificates.
